My tutoring approach focuses on turning abstract formulas into intuitive, physical realities. By combining my background in Physics and Mechanical Engineering, I help students see the "why" behind the math.

1. Methodology: The "First Principles" Approach

I don't believe in rote memorization. My technique relies on active problem-solving:Concept Mapping: We start with the core physical laws (F = ma, energy conservation, etc.) and derive solutions from there.

Socratic Questioning: I guide you through a problem with targeted questions rather than just providing the answer, ensuring you develop the logic to solve it independently next time.

2. A Typical 60-Minute Lesson Plan

To ensure maximum retention, I structure sessions as follows:

00-10 min: Review of previous concepts.
10-30 min: Deep dive into the current theory.
30-50 min: Co-piloted practice where you lead the derivation.
50-60 min: Summary of key takeaways and next steps.

3. What Sets Me Apart

I bridge the gap between theoretical physics and applied engineering. Having navigated a Master’s degree, I know exactly where students usually trip up. I use real-world engineering examples—like bridge loading or engine cycles—to make dry textbook problems come alive.

4. Who I Teach

I support students across various levels who are pursuing STEM paths:

University Students: Core Mechanical Engineering courses (Statics, Dynamics, Thermodynamics, Fluid Mechanics) and upper-level Physics.

High School Students: AP/IB Physics and advanced Mathematics.
